Hope you still remember Sue Donovan,a friend in New Hamshire who's rescued some abandoned chihuahuas and lived with them as happy family.

Sue sent me more pictures of her chis with a story of huge ice storm there which happened past few months.It makes me very exited.

In her letter she said:
I don't know of your news covered the huge ice storm we had... We lost all power and heat for several days. It could have been very bad - but I have the most wonderful neighbors on the planet. We lost everything Thursday night about 11PM, my next door neighbor came over to check on me at about 9AM Friday. When he realized I had no wood for my wood stove he got some others together. They chipped in their own wood so I could have some heat in the house! They also were going to take all of my dogs in so they could be warm. Once the wood stove was going everything was better. We did have the power restored until yesterday. There are still many people in New England who have no power or heat and it is going to get very cold again. My pipes burst twice! But there are lots of people who are in much worse shape!
